Uji Penghambatan Aktivitas alfa-glukosidase Ekstrak dan Fraksi Daun Antidesma montanum Blume
Abstract: alpha-Glucosidase
inhibitor has known to be a therapeutic agent for diabetes mellitus (DM) treatment,
especially type 2 DM. Based on previous studies. There are various plants that
have the effect of inhibiting the activity of a-glucosidase, one of which is
garu leaves (Antidesma montanum Blume). This research aimed to get the fraction
which had the highest Il-glucosidase inhibiting activity from ethanol extract
of garu leaves and identify the chemical compounds from the most active
fraction. Simplisia powder was extracted by maseration using 80% ethanol then
fractionated using n-hexane, ethyl acetate, and methanol. Inhibitory activity
test was performed by measuring absorbance of p-nitrophenol, which produced by
reaction between Il-glucosidase and p-nitrophenyl-u-l)-glucopyranoside, using
microplate reader at 405 nm. The result showed that ethyl acetate fraction have
the best Il-glucosidase inhibitory activity with IC50 values 138.38 ppm. The
test of enzyme kinetics showed that ethyl acetate fraction inhibited
competitively. The phytochemical screening showed that ethyl acetate fraction
of garu leaves contained glycosides, tannins, and terpenes.
